Sourcing guidance for Triangular File
What are the key technical specifications to consider when sourcing industrial-grade triangular files?
When evaluating triangular files, you must prioritize High-Carbon Steel (T12 or T13) or Alloy Steel for the core material to ensure a hardness level of HRC 60-65. The tooth geometry is critical; for general metalwork, a double-cut pattern is preferred for rapid material removal, while a single-cut pattern is better for a smooth finish. Additionally, verify the taper consistency—the file should narrow uniformly toward the point to allow access to tight angles and corners.
How do I choose the correct 'cut' or coarseness for different B2B applications?
Selection depends on the required surface finish. Bastard cut files are ideal for heavy stock removal in fabrication; Second cut offers a balance between speed and finish for general engineering; and Smooth cut is essential for precision tool-and-die work. For bulk procurement, it is advisable to source a mixed-set ratio that aligns with your clients' specific industrial needs, ensuring all files meet DIN 7261 or ISO 234-2 standards.
What compliance and quality standards should a professional buyer verify?
Ensure the manufacturer adheres to ISO 9001 for quality management. For safety and ergonomics, check if the handles (if included) meet REACH or RoHS requirements, especially for plastic or bi-material grips to ensure they are free from harmful phthalates. A critical quality test is the uniformity of the teeth height; uneven teeth lead to 'chatter' and poor surface quality. Request a metallurgical test report to confirm the carbon content and heat treatment depth.
What are the common usage scenarios for triangular files in an industrial context?
Triangular files, also known as three-square files, are primarily used for filing internal angles, clearing out square corners, and sharpening saw teeth (specifically 60-degree angles). They are indispensable in mold making, metal deburring, and woodworking tool maintenance. For specialized electronics or jewelry applications, you should source needle triangular files which offer higher precision for intricate detailing.
Cross-Border Procurement & Risk Management for Abrasive Tools
How can I mitigate the risk of receiving brittle or low-quality steel products?
The primary risk in sourcing steel tools is improper heat treatment, leading to files that snap or dull instantly. To mitigate this, request a pre-shipment inspection (PSI) where a third party performs a hardness test and a functional filing test on random samples. What are the best practices for negotiating with triangular file manufacturers?
Focus negotiations on unit weight and material grade rather than just the lowest price, as 'cheap' files often use recycled steel. Ask for tiered pricing based on MOQ (e.g., 1,000 vs. 5,000 units) and negotiate for customized branding (OEM) on the tang or handle, which adds value for resale. Requesting free samples is standard; however, offer to cover the air express cost to demonstrate your serious intent as a professional buyer.
What shipping and packaging precautions are necessary for heavy metal tools?
Triangular files are heavy and prone to surface rust during sea transit. Ensure the supplier uses VCI (Volatile Corrosion Inhibitor) paper or anti-rust oil coating for each unit. For bulk shipping, specify double-walled corrugated export cartons with a weight limit of 15-20kg per box to prevent box collapse. For shipping to regions with high humidity, moisture-absorbent silica gel packs should be included in every inner box.
How do international trade policies affect the sourcing of hand tools?
Be aware of Anti-Dumping Duties (ADD) that some countries impose on steel hand tools from specific regions. Check your local Harmonized System (HS) Code (typically 8203.10) to determine the exact import tariffs. Ensure the supplier provides a Certificate of Origin (CO), which may help you qualify for preferential tariff rates under various Free Trade Agreements (FTAs).
